What Makes a Basket Luxurious?Luxury baskets are the high‑end version of a gourmet meal—rich, indulgent, and unforgettable. Think of them as the “red carpet” of gifting.
Premium MaterialsLuxury baskets often use:
Sturdy, high‑quality wooden or bamboo crates Elegant fabric wraps or silk ribbons Crystal or glass accentsThese materials not only look good but feel substantial, giving the recipient a sense of value.
Curated SelectionsInstead of a random assortment, luxury baskets feature:
Artisan chocolates or truffles Organic or single‑origin teas and coffees Hand‑crafted soaps or scented candlesEach item is chosen for its superior quality and unique flavor profile.
Presentation and PackagingLuxury baskets go beyond simple wrapping. They may include:
Custom‑printed labels Decorative gift tags with calligraphy A final flourish of fresh flowers or dried herbsThe packaging itself becomes part of the experience, turning the basket into a work of art.
Standard Baskets: The Everyday ChoiceStandard baskets are the dependable, go‑to option. They’re like the reliable sedan—no frills, but dependable and practical.
Cost‑Effective Options Affordable packaging such as paper or plastic baskets Bulk items that stretch the budget Standard gift items like generic chocolates or store‑brand teasThe focus is on quantity and variety rather than extravagance.
Versatile ContentsStandard baskets can be themed (e.g., “movie night” or “office snack”) but usually include:
Convenient snacks Basic self‑care items Seasonal treatsThey’re perfect for last‑minute gifts or when you’re unsure of the recipient’s taste.
Comparing the Two: A Side‑by‑Side Look| Feature | Luxury Basket | Standard Basket |

|---------|---------------|-----------------|
| Price | $150–$500+ | $30–$100 |
| Material | Premium wood, silk, crystal | Paper, plastic, basic wood |
| Item Quality | Artisan, single‑origin | Mass‑produced, generic |
| Packaging | Custom, high‑end | Functional, simple |
| Occasion Suitability | Special milestones, corporate gifts | Everyday gifts, casual occasions |

Practical Tips for Selecting the Right Basket Budgeting Set a clear limit: Decide how much you’re willing to spend before browsing. Consider the occasion: A corporate gift may justify a higher spend than a casual thank‑you note. Knowing Your Recipient Taste: Do they prefer sweet or savory? Lifestyle: Are they a fitness enthusiast, a foodie, or a homebody? Cultural preferences: Some cultures value modesty; others appreciate lavishness. Where to Buy Specialty stores: Offer curated luxury baskets with expert advice. Online marketplaces: Provide a wide range of options, from budget to premium. Local artisans: Often produce unique, handcrafted items that add a personal touch.
